William H. Taft

Signed White House card, boldly signed in black ink, “Wm. H. Taft.” Nicely double matted and framed with a New York Times 14 x 11 silver gelatin photo of Taft throwing out the first pitch ever by a president at a Major League baseball game on April 14, 1910, where he threw the ball to Washington Senators player Walter Johnson, to an overall size of 17.25 19.5. In very good condition, with light overall toning, a few spots of trivial soiling, and a light fingerprint to closing of signature, quite possibly Taft’s. Pre-certified John Reznikoff/PSA/DNA and RRAuction COA.
